China was the first country to invent papermaking and printing, and paper appeared in the first century BC. At the beginning of the second century, Cai Lun improved the paper-making method. Since then, books have been copied and spread on paper. Around the eighth century, woodblock printing was invented, which can print hundreds of books at a time, which is a big step forward from the past handwriting era.
Temples and Buddhists are very dry, so they use the emerging folk block printing as a tool to promote Buddhism. In addition to the small Buddha statues printed, there are sometimes big Buddha statues and dharmas. At the end of the Tang Dynasty, Sikong Tu wrote an article about engraving and gave it to the monk Huique of Notre Dame de Luoyang. He once said that the printed version was * * * 800 sheets, indicating that the Charity Law had been printed in the temple at that time. The Diamond Sutra, a volume carved by Wang D at his own expense in 868 AD (that is, the ninth year of Tang Xiantong) found in Dunhuang, is the earliest existing woodcut, made up of seven pieces of paper. The first picture of Sakyamuni Buddha's statement, with beautiful knife technique and solemn expression, is a work close to the maturity of printmaking. It is really sad that this world-famous engraved Buddhist scripture of the Tang Dynasty was stolen by Stein, an Englishman, more than 50 years ago.
In recent years, a Sanskrit Dalagni Jing printed by Kajia in Chengdu was unearthed from the Tang Tomb in Chengdu. A small Buddhist sutra was carved in the middle, a Sanskrit Buddhist mantra was carved outside, and a small Buddha statue was carved outside the mantra. This is the oldest extant Tang engraving in China. At that time, Chengdu was the center of southwest cultural publishing. The books printed in various periods of the Tang Dynasty were limited to popular reading materials and Buddhist classics commonly used by the general public, which laid a good technical foundation for the Shu edition of the Song Dynasty.
In 97 1 year (that is, four years after the treasure was opened in the Northern Song Dynasty), the Song Dynasty sent people to Chengdu to engrave more than 5,000 volumes of the Tripitaka, which was a huge published work, and Shu Ben was famous for it.
In 975 (the eighth year of the Northern Song Dynasty), the Dalagni Sutra (the Tibetan Sutra of Leifeng Pagoda), which was created by Qian Mu, the king of Wu Yue, is the oldest surviving version in Zhejiang, with neat fonts, similar to the fine print Buddhist Sutra later carved in Hangzhou. In recent years, the remains of Buddhist scriptures carved in the early Northern Song Dynasty found under Longquan Pagoda in Zhejiang Province have a wide font, which is similar to the official version of the Southern Song Dynasty. It can be seen that since the end of the Five Dynasties, a large number of skilled engraving workers have appeared in Hangzhou and other parts of Zhejiang. No wonder most prison books in the Northern Song Dynasty are Zhejiang books.
In the Song Dynasty, in addition to the Zhejiang edition, the simplified edition (Fujian Jianyang Engraving Edition) was also quite famous. During the Song, Jin and Yuan Dynasties, Hangzhou, Zhejiang, Jianyang, Fujian, Meishan, Chengdu, Sichuan, and Pingyang, Shanxi (now Linfen, Shanxi) were four major cultural areas, and a large number of books were printed and sold all over the country. The Taoist collection in Yuan Dynasty was carved in Pingyang. In other areas, some bookstores or private individuals have printed many Buddhist scriptures and other books in large and small characters, many of which are exquisite products.
Beijing is the capital of Ming and Qing dynasties, and it is also the national engraving and printing center. Private seal engravings such as Beizang, Daozang and Longzang are rare in the past, with fine paper and ink and exquisite carvings. The paper used, such as cotton paper, bamboo paper, chemical paper, wool paper and other new varieties, is also increasing.
Long before the great development of block printing; China's woodcuts have appeared. In the middle of the seventh century, Master Xuanzang of the Tang Dynasty printed Bodhisattvas on back paper and distributed them in all directions. The paintings of the Diamond Sutra carved by Wang D at the end of the Tang Dynasty and many religious paintings found in Dunhuang gradually became proficient in art, and the paintings of the title pages of books carved in the Song and Yuan Dynasties developed from religious books to general books. There are a lot of Buddhist scriptures engraved in various bookstores in the Ming Dynasty, with few illustrations.
In A.D. 1340 (six years from Yuan Dynasty to Yuan Dynasty), Zhu Mo was overprinted with the Diamond Sutra Annotation of Unknown Monk, which is the earliest existing woodcut overprint. /kloc-At the end of 0/6th century, bookstores in Xing Wu, Hangzhou and Nanjing also used Zhu Mo and multicolor to overprint various books, which was dazzling.
